Overview
The ROClean A Acid Cleaning Kit is a purpose-engineered maintenance solution designed specifically for the safe, effective, and repeatable chemical decontamination of critical components within ultra-pure water (UPW) systems. Unlike generic laboratory cleaners, ROClean A utilizes a precisely formulated solid-phase citric acid–based tablet formulation optimized for low-residue dissolution, controlled pH modulation (targeting pH 2.0–2.5 in standard dilution), and compatibility with stainless steel 316L, PVDF, and EPDM wetted materials commonly found in UPW generation and distribution assemblies. The kit operates on a validated cleaning principle: chelation-driven removal of metal oxide deposits (e.g., Fe₂O₃, NiO), carbonate scale, and trace heavy metal contaminants that accumulate over time on conductivity/resistivity cells, online TOC sensor flow cells, and recirculation pump impellers—thereby restoring measurement accuracy, minimizing drift, and extending component service life without requiring disassembly or aggressive nitric/hydrochloric acid handling.
Key Features
- Pre-weighed, stabilized citric acid tablets (1.5 g ± 0.05 g per tablet) ensure consistent dosing and eliminate manual weighing errors.
- Non-oxidizing, chloride-free chemistry prevents pitting corrosion on 316L stainless steel piping and sensor housings—critical for ISO 14644-1 Class 4–5 cleanroom UPW loops.
- Low foaming profile enables use in pressurized recirculation cleaning protocols without air entrapment or sensor signal interference.
- Residue-free rinse profile verified by <10 ppb total organic carbon (TOC) post-rinse when following recommended 3× volume flush protocol (per ASTM D5127 Annex A3).
- Stable shelf life of 24 months when stored sealed at 15–25°C; no refrigeration required.
- Each tablet dissolves fully within 90 seconds in 500 mL deionized water at 25°C, generating a homogeneous cleaning solution with minimal particulate carryover.

Applications
- Quarterly scheduled cleaning of resistivity sensor electrodes in point-of-use (POU) purification modules.
- Recovery intervention after elevated TOC excursions (>500 ppt) traced to distribution loop biofilm or metal leaching.
- Pre-commissioning passivation verification for newly installed UPW piping networks prior to system qualification (IQ/OQ).
- Maintenance of ultraviolet (UV) lamp quartz sleeves where mineral scaling reduces 185/254 nm transmission efficiency.
- Decontamination of high-purity filter housings (e.g., 0.1 µm PTFE membrane cartridges) between integrity test cycles.
FAQ
Can ROClean A be used for stainless steel electropolished piping passivation?
No. ROClean A is designed for routine cleaning—not passivation. Passivation requires nitric or citric acid solutions at elevated temperatures (≥50°C) and extended dwell times per ASTM A967 or AMS 2700; ROClean A is formulated for ambient-temperature, short-duration (15–30 min) cleaning only.
Is rinsing validation required after ROClean A treatment?
Yes. Final rinse conductivity must be ≤0.1 µS/cm and TOC ≤10 ppb, measured per ASTM D5127 Section 8.1, prior to system return-to-service.
Does ROClean A contain any phosphates or silicates?
No. The formulation is strictly phosphate-free, silicate-free, and amine-free to prevent downstream membrane fouling or interference with low-level ion chromatography analysis.
What is the maximum recommended storage temperature?
25°C. Prolonged exposure above 30°C may accelerate citric acid hydrolysis and reduce tablet integrity; humidity control (<60% RH) is advised.
Can ROClean A tablets be dissolved in hot water to accelerate dissolution?
Not recommended. Temperatures >40°C risk premature degradation of stabilizers and increase potential for localized crystallization upon cooling—both compromising cleaning efficacy and rinse residue performance.
